  • 1

    Lymphoma is a malignant disorder with increasing global incidence, characterized by aggressive behavior and multi-organ involvement.

  • 2

    Functional imaging, particularly ¹⁸F-FDG PET/CT, is crucial for diagnosing lymphoma and assessing treatment response.

  • 3

    Diffuse FDG uptake in the spleen and bone marrow may indicate systemic inflammation and has unclear prognostic significance in lymphoma.

  • 4

    The study aims to evaluate the prognostic value of diffuse FDG uptake in lymphoma patients and its correlation with inflammatory markers.

  • 5

    Integrating PET/CT metrics with inflammatory parameters may enhance prognostic stratification and guide individualized treatment strategies.
